RAMAN. is a multi-talented artist who tests the boundaries between melancholy and hope with nothing more than his voice, guitar and soul. His debut album “I do” gives melancholy a place to live, while carving out a space for his own voice: a cosmic journey through self-reflection, loss and rebirth. It invites listeners to surrender to the wild, unpredictable nature of life: a call to reconnect with yourself, your surroundings and the reality you shape, with all the infinite possibilities it holds.

“I do” traces a personal voyage through his twenties: a decade marked by searching, experimenting and reinventing oneself. It documents the struggle with performance anxiety and the suffocating pursuit of perfection: a process of letting go, believing and learning to trust. It’s a search for personal truth, values and inner ground, shaped into sounds that are both fragile and resolute. The album is dedicated to his close friend and mentor, blues musician Tiny Legs Tim (R.I.P.), whose spirit continues to resonate through the music.

In intimate whispers and sweeping melodies, RAMAN. bares his deepest fears and desires. The music breathes honesty: from desolate slide guitars to warm nylon strings, from fragile silence to explosive release. Hovering somewhere between blues and pop, between the ethereal and the earthy, he seeks connection with himself, with his roots and with the listener.

Together with his band (Kris Auman on bass, Sylvester Vanborm on drums), RAMAN. recorded the album with producer and musical guide Koen Gisen. Contributions from David Poltrock (mellotron, keys), Esther Coorevits (viola) and Gisen himself (saxophone, clarinet) lend the album a warm, layered depth. The result sounds more polished than its raw predecessor, the “Birth of Joy” EP (2019), yet it preserves the emotional grit at its core.

Echoes of Jeff Buckley, Chris Whitley and Radiohead can be felt, but above all RAMAN. remains true to himself: a traveller through his own universe, searching for light in the dark.

“I do” is a vow to life itself and to imperfection, change and courage. Born out of loss, carried by hope. An intimate record that offers solace in the unknown.
